fix: use resume_parser extractors in import endpoint to clean CID glyphs

The import endpoint was doing its own inline PDF/DOCX/ODT extraction
without calling _clean_cid(). Bullet CIDs (127, 149, 183) and other
ATS-reembedded font artifacts were stored raw, surfacing as (cid:127)
in the resume library. Switch to extract_text_from_pdf/docx/odt from
resume_parser.py which already handle two-column layouts and CID cleaning.
